101 Really Useful PHRASAL VERBS

1- To abide by:

To accept and be guided by something, obey

There are rules and you must abide by the rules.

2- To ask around:

To ask many people to tell you information about someone or something

I asked around but nobody wanted to buy my spare ticket.

3- To ask someone out:

To ask someone to go for a date with you

She is a very nice girl. Do you think I should ask her out?

4- To back out:

To decide not to do something that you had agreed to do

You are getting married in 20 minutes it's too late to back out now.
